Full Stack Developer - CISA - 020305
Do you enjoy working with new technologies on agile development teams?SimonComputing is seeking a Full Stack Developer with strong systems, software, cloud, and Agile experience. You will work collaboratively with software developers to deliver high-quality software for the Cybersecurity &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) that sits within the Department of Homeland Security (DHS). You will work on projects through all aspects of the software development life cycle including scope and work estimation, architecture and design, coding and unit testing.Position requires US citizenship.Responsibilities- Will work within a fast-paced Agile DevOps team contributing and collaborating within your scrum team on a daily basis.
- Analyze software requirements and provide solutions.
- Perform analysis, design, coding, testing, implementation, and maintenance of software solutions.
- Provide Full Stack software development support for User Interfaces, REST APIs, Data Access Layers.
- Ensure software developed passes and completes stages within the CI pipeline.
